The Advent of Advanced Task Automation

OpenAI's latest venture into developing two sophisticated AI agents is seen as a natural progression in its mission to push the boundaries of AI technology. While details of the project are still emerging, the core objective is clear: to create AI systems that can autonomously perform complex tasks with unprecedented precision and adaptability.

The significance of this development cannot be overstated. Current AI technologies excel at specific, narrowly defined tasks but often struggle with activities that require a higher level of cognitive flexibility and decision-making. OpenAI's initiative aims to bridge this gap, offering AI solutions that can navigate the complexities of such tasks with ease.

Potential Impacts and Applications

The implications of successfully developing these AI agents are far-reaching. In sectors such as healthcare, finance, and customer service, these AI systems could automate processes that currently require significant human labor, thereby increasing efficiency and reducing costs. Furthermore, in creative industries, these agents could assist in generating innovative designs, writing content, or even composing music, pushing the boundaries of AI-assisted creativity.

Another critical area of impact is the realm of data analysis and decision-making. With the ability to process and analyze vast amounts of information rapidly, these AI agents could aid in making more informed decisions in fields like climate science, where analyzing complex data patterns is crucial for predicting environmental changes.

Ethical Considerations and Challenges

As with any advancement in AI, the development of these agents brings its set of ethical considerations and challenges. Issues such as data privacy, security, and the potential displacement of jobs necessitate a careful approach to the deployment of these technologies. OpenAI has historically been vocal about the importance of ethical AI development, and it is expected that these new projects will continue to adhere to these principles.

Moreover, ensuring that these AI agents can operate safely and reliably in unpredictable environments is another challenge that OpenAI will need to navigate. The complexity of real-world tasks means that these systems must be robust against a wide range of scenarios, including those that may not have been anticipated during their training.
